marker.js features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Marker.js provides an intuitive and easy-to-use interface for users to annotate images quickly without needing extensive technical knowledge.
  • Real-time Collaboration
    The tool supports real-time collaboration, allowing multiple users to work on the same annotation project simultaneously, which enhances teamwork efficiency.
  • Customizable Annotation Tools
    Marker.js offers a variety of customizable annotation tools, enabling users to tailor their annotation experience according to specific needs.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    The software is compatible with various web technologies and can be seamlessly integrated into different platforms and applications.
  • Lightweight and Fast
    Being a lightweight solution, Marker.js loads quickly and performs efficiently, which is ideal for web applications with performance constraints.

Possible disadvantages of marker.js

  • Feature Limitations
    While Marker.js offers a solid set of annotation tools, advanced users might find it lacking in features compared to more comprehensive annotation software.
  • Dependency on Web Environment
    As a web-based tool, Marker.js relies on an internet connection and compatible browsers, which may not suit environments that require offline access.
  • Potential Learning Curve
    New users may experience a learning curve when first using Marker.js, particularly if they are accustomed to different annotation tools.
  • Limited Support for Specialized Use Cases
    Organizations with highly specialized annotation needs might find Marker.js less suitable, necessitating additional tools or custom solutions.
